In execution of the Cabinet’s Decision calling for conducting local elections on Saturday, April 25, 2026, and in reference to the powers vested in the Central Elections Commission (CEC) in accordance with the provisions of the Decree-Law No. (23) of 2025, concerning the Elections of Local Authority Councils, the CEC issued a guiding leaflet on nomination to municipal councils and another on nomination to village councils.
The nomination stage commences for 7 days starting Monday morning, February 23, 2026 and concluding the night of Sunday, March 1, 2026

Nomination for Municipal Councils
Electoral List: is every list nominated for participating in the elections of municipal councils, which the CEC accepted the nomination thereof, and whose name is listed in the Final Registry of Lists and Candidates.
- Registration and nomination of electoral lists shall be through submitting a request using the dedicated form.
- The Request Form for the nomination of an electoral list can be acquired from the CEC’s central office in Al-Bireh, or any of the Electoral District Offices spread across all governorates, or through the CEC’s official website.
- The electoral list registration and nomination form shall be submitted to the Electoral District Office, which the local authority is affiliated with, where the electoral list desires to be nominated for the membership of and compete for its seats.
- Electoral list registration and nomination forms will continue to be received by the CEC for 7 days starting the morning of Monday, February 23, 2026 and ending the evening of Sunday, March 1, 2026.
- Electoral list names will appear on the ballot paper according to the order in which its nomination application was submitted to the CEC.
Electoral List Representative: The individual delegated by the list to sign on its behalf, submit and follow up requests and necessary supporting document throughout the electoral process, and to represent the list before the CEC and other relevant competent authorities.
The Electoral List Registration and Nomination Form comprises of the following:
- Name of the Electoral District and Local Authority, the council of which the list is nominated for.
- Name of electoral list, logo and slogan.
- Nature of Nomination.
- Address of list’s premises, if any.
- Name and address of the list representative, authorized to sign on its behalf.
- Electoral list registration and nomination form attachments.
- Declaration and commitment from the electoral list candidates, representative and campaign manager.
- Full names of candidates and their order in the list, their ages, dates of birth, addresses, religion, and registration number as listed in the voters’ registry, and nicknames, if any.
- Name and address of the legal proxy of candidate, in case the application was submitted through a legal proxy.
- Sources of funding the electoral campaign.
Attached to the electoral list registration and nomination form are the following:
- Electoral Agenda: a hard copy and a soft copy of the list’s electoral agenda.
- Electoral Slogan or Logo: a colored picture of the electoral slogan or logo of the list signed by its representative and attached in a soft copy with the following specifications: colored image (extension JPEG), 2x2cm dimensions, the size no bigger than 300 kb, and a resolution of 200 DPI.
- Amounts for nomination and insuring electoral campaigning: a bank bond at the value of (2000); two thousand Jordanian Dinars for both amounts for nomination and insuring electoral campaigning deposited in cash to the CEC’s account titled Nominees Insurances No. (2222000) at the Ramallah branch of Bank of Palestine, or by depositing the amount at any of Bank Palestine branches spread across the country.
- A letter from the representative of the political faction (for the lists of political factions): a letter from the Secretary General of the political faction indicating the approval of the nomination list submitted in the application of the political faction.
- Proof of identity: a copy of the ID to prove the identity of each candidate.
- Personal photo: a recent photograph (2 copies) with dimensions of 2x3 cm for each candidate.
- Declaration and Commitment: per candidate.
- Resignation: a letter of accepting the resignation of candidates, if candidates were employees of the Ministry of Local Government, or of any of the security forces, Mayor or member of a local authority council, an employee, attendant or lawyer at the local authority he/she intends to be nominated for the membership of its council
- Financial Clearance Certificate: a financial clearance certificate issued by the local authority council where the candidate desires to be nominated for the membership of, indicating that said candidate has paid all due fees, taxes, penalties and violations in favor of the council until January 31, 2026.
- Power of Attorney: a special power of attorney issued by the court’s clerk or one the Palestinian Embassies for candidates who can not submit their applications in person, which is applicable to Palestinian Prisoners in Israeli prisons through their lawyer or the Red Cross.
Nomination for Village Councils
- Registration and nomination of candidates for the membership of village council is achieved using the form designated for that purpose.
- The form for nomination for the membership of village councils can be acquired from the central office of the CEC in Al-Bireh, or any of the other Electoral District Offices spread across all governorates, or through the CEC’s official website.
- The form for nomination for the membership of village council is submitted to the Electoral District Office that the local authority is affiliated with, which the candidate desires to be nominated for the membership of its council and to compete for its seats.
- Nomination applications for village council candidates shall be received for 7 days, starting the morning of Monday, February 23, 2026 and ending the evening of Sunday, March 1, 2026.
- The names of candidates for the village council will appear on the ballot paper in the order in which their nomination applications where submitted to the CEC.
The form concerning the nomination for the village council membership comprises of the following:
- Name of the electoral district and the village council of which the candidates are nominated for.
- Personal information of the candidate and ID number, registration number in the voters’ registry, full name, age, date of birth, address, religion, and nickname, if any.
- Name and address of the candidate’s legal proxy, in case the candidate submitted the form through a legal proxy.
- Email address of the electoral campaign (if any).
- Sources of funding the electoral campaign, and in the case of opening a bank account for the campaign, details of the account must be mentioned.
Attached to the form of nomination for the membership of village councils shall be the following documents:
- Electoral agenda: a soft copy and a hard copy of the agenda.
- The nomination fees and electoral campaigning insurance: bank bond proving both amounts, the nomination fees and electoral campaigning insurance at the value of (300) three hundred Jordanian Dinars, in cash, deposited to the CEC’s account of insuring candidates (No. 2222000) at Bank of Palestine, Ramallah branch, or to deposit the amounts at any of the Bank of Palestine branches spread across all governorates.
- Proof of identity: a copy of the candidate’s ID.
- Personal photo: a recent personal photo (2), dimensions 2*3cm per candidate.
- Declaration and commitment: from the candidate.
- Resignation: a letter of accepting resignation from current job, if the candidate is an employee or attendant at the Ministry of Local Government, or the security forces, a mayor or member of a local authority council, an employee, attendant or lawyer of the local authority he/she intends to be nominated for the membership of its council.
- Debt Clearance: financial clearance certificate issued by the local authority council the candidate desires to be nominated for the council of, stating that all fees, taxes, penalties are paid in favor of the council until January 31, 2026.
- Power of attorney: a special power of attorney issued by the clerk or one of the Palestinian embassies for candidates who can’t submit their own applications, acceptable for Palestinian prisoners through his/her lawyer or the Red Cross.
Nomination for the elections of local authority councils is the right of every Palestinian who meets the eligibility criteria
- Age: 23 years old, born on April 23, 2003 or before.
- Registration: Candidate’s name listed in the final Voters’ Registry at the local authority he/she desires to be nominated for the membership of its council.
- Not convicted: Not to be convicted of a felony or misdemeanor violating morality, honor or honesty, unless pardoned.
- Resignation: Not to be an employee or attendant at the Ministry of Local Government or one of the Security Forces, or a mayor or member of the local authority council, or an employee, a lawyer or attendant of the local authority nominated for the membership of its council, attaching its approval of nomination application.
- Double nomination: candidates shall not be nominated in more than one local authority or electoral list.
Nomination fees for the Elections of Local Authority Councils
The Decree-Law No. (23) of 2025, concerning the Elections of Local Authority Councils determined the irredeemable fees for the nomination of an electoral list for the membership of a municipal council or a candidate for the membership of a village council as follows:
- One thousand Jordanian Dinars (1000 JOD) per electoral list.
- One hundred Jordanian Dinars (100 JOD) per candidate nominated for village council membership.
Amounts mentioned in article (a) shall be deposited in cash to the CEC’s account for candidates’ insurance No. (2222000) at Bank of Palestine - Ramallah branch, or any of its other branches spread across all governorates.
Nomination fees shall be returned in case:
- Withdrawal of electoral lists’ nomination for the membership of municipal council or village councils starting nomination stage until the day preceding the exhibition of the final register.
- Rejection of nomination application of candidates for village councils and electoral lists for municipal councils.
- Electoral list is cancelled due to number of candidates mounting up to less than two thirds of the seats of the municipal council nominated for, and was not able to correct their conditions during the legal period dedicated to that purpose.
Electoral Campaigning Insurance Amount
The Decree-Law No. (23) of 2025, concerning the Elections of Local Authority Councils, and its amendments determined the insurance amount for electoral campaigning of electoral lists and candidates as follows:
- One thousand Jordanian Dinars (1000), per electoral list nominated for municipal councils.
- Two hundred Jordanian Dinars (200), per candidate for the membership of village councils.
Amounts mentioned in Article (a) above shall be deposited in cash into the account of the CEC – Candidates Insurances No. (2222000) at Bank of Palestine, Ramallah branch, or at any of the Bank of Palestine branches spread across all governorates.
Electoral campaigning insurance shall be returned in case:
- Candidates of village councils and electoral lists adhered to the provisions of electoral campaigning enshrined in the Decree-Law No. (23) of 2025, concerning the Elections of Local Authority Councils and its amendments, CEC’s procedures, and submission of financial report detailing the costs and sources of funding the electoral campaign and items of expenditure. In addition to removing all representation of electoral campaigning no later than three months following polling day.
- Withdrawal of candidate’s nomination from village councils and electoral list’s nomination from municipal councils until end of Monday, March 30, 2026.
- If a candidate’s nomination application for the membership of a village council or that of an electoral list for municipal councils is denied.
- If the electoral list was cancelled due to have a number of candidates less than two-thirds of the seats of the municipal council, and was not able to correct its conditions during the legal period dedicated for that purpose.
Rejection of candidates’ nomination for local authority councils
The registration of a candidate or an electoral list is rejected if:
- The application appears not to meet eligibility criteria of candidates or electoral lists as stated in the previously mentioned Decree-Law.
- The data provided in the application appears to be incorrect or inaccurate or lack of supporting documents.
- The electoral list submitted a request for accrediting a logo or slogan in violation of public order or morals, or if it was identical to a slogan that belongs to another political faction or registered electoral list or one that submitted a nomination application to the CEC, or if it belongs to an unregistered political organization, however, commonly known in the Palestinian territory.
- The electoral list submitted a registration application under a name or slogan that implies it belongs to the State of Palestine, affiliated with it or protected by law.
- If the candidate or electoral list did not provide a letter per candidate indicating the payment of al due fees and taxes in favor of the council they desire to be nominated for.
Preliminary Register of Candidates and Electoral Lists
The CEC publishes the preliminary register of electoral lists and candidates nominated for village councils in the CEC centers and offices in the districts as well as the premises of local authorities on Saturday, March 7, 2026.
Preliminary register of candidates and electoral lists shall be exhibited for three days so that lists and candidates can verify their data and to enable voters to view the names of their lists and candidates, and to practice their right to submit challenges against them if the invalidity of the nomination of candidate or electoral list is proven.
Withdrawal of Nomination for the Elections of Local Councils
- Candidates of an electoral list may submit a request withdrawing their nomination until Sunday, March 1, 2026, through the electoral list representative.
- Candidates of village councils and electoral lists may withdraw their nomination, by submitting a written letter to the CEC using the designated form, given notification is provided before exhibiting the final register.
Accreditation of electoral list agent
Electoral lists and candidates of village council have the right to submit agent accreditation requests for observing the electoral process on their behalf, given that the agent accreditation period starts on Wednesday, April 4, 2026 until Friday, April 24, 2026, if the following criteria are met:
- To be 20 years or older on polling day.
- Not to be an employee or attendant at one of the Security Forces.
- Not to be an employee of the local authority, Ministry of Local Government, the CEC or to be retired from either.
- Adherence to the code of conduct issued by the CEC.
- Agent’s accreditation request shall be submitted by the candidate in the case of village councils and electoral list representative in municipal councils using the designated form.
Agent accreditation request
The request for accreditation of the agent shall use the designated form.
The request should include the following information:
- Candidate’s name or name of Electoral List he/she belongs to.
- Personal data of the agent and contact information.
- Declaration and commitment from agent to adhere to the law, regulations and code of conduct issued by the CEC.
- Name and signature of candidate or electoral list representative.
